How it started?

Our trusty old M800 from 1995 was past it’s prime and needed to be replaced. The car was primarily supposed to be for the ladies of the family and the hunt began. The requirements were AC & PS. No other fancy stuff was needed. The options short listed were
Alto800 – This was the only version available in Mar 2010
A Star
Spark PS (After GTO’s post)

Alto 800 was rejected straight up as it was not much different from the M800 to the ladies in terms of feel and comfort. Of course they loved the PS.

A-Star was rejected due to the high dashboard-low seating combo

Spark struck the Spark with the ladies!! They loved the interior, exterior, refinement of the engine, everything and everything about it. Whew! So it was finally decided and we booked a white Spark PS.

Running in, Interiors and Exteriors:

Religiously followed the running in instructions as per the user manual and also got the first oil change at the 1000 kms assurance check. Spark is a very well sorted package in terms of interior/exterior design, suspension, NVH, well almost everything.

Interiors: Though not to the i10 standards, the beige interiors do make the innards very lively and inviting every time I take the car out for a drive. You don’t walk into the car like the Santro or dump yourself into the low seat of Alto. The seats are a go-between the Santro and Alto.
The cubby holes are dime a dozen and you will never run out of cubby holes to store your chewing gum, mobile, wallet, audio remote and a plethora of other stuff that you might carry in the car or on your person.
The front 2 seats are excellent in terms of comfort, while the rear runs short of space if I am driving. I am 6’0 and have to rack the seat all the way back. With the back rest angle set to my comfortable driving position, no one taller than 5’1 can sit comfortably in the seat behind me for more than an hour. For short city rides, it’s perfectly fine.

Exteriors: Again, full marks to Chevy for the well thought out exteriors. To be honest, for the first few weeks, I felt the car to be girly. But then it kind of grew on me and after a month, it actually started appealing to me like how a charming girl appeals to a guy. She looks best in the side view as compared to any other angle. Very good paint quality and nothing to complain about.

Drive Experience:
Honestly, having owned a 2005 Zen MPFI for a short time, I was disappointed with the peppiness of the car. I found it to be sluggish and was left wanting for more. But gradually I started to understand the strengths of the car as time passed.
AMAZING low end torque, due to which you can cruise in the city all day in 3rd gear at speeds of 25-30kmph without the engine showing any signs of lugging. Fantastic. With the traffic in B’lore going for bad to worse, this was a boon. And it would pull cleanly in 3rd from 1100 RPM up to 2000 RPM.
Refinement is top notch. I ended up cranking the car when it was started as the engine was totally inaudible. Full marks to Chevy for the engine refinement. The blower is the only sound heard inside the car once you roll up the windows. Well insulated cabin as well though you can hear a bit of road noise.
Suspension is perfect for our road conditions and well set up. Though the reports are suggesting the suspension can get bust in a year or 2, touch wood, there are no problems in the last 14 months of ownership. The ride quality is top notch and body roll is minimal. You can take mild curves at 80kmph confidently.
Tires are Acceleres from Appolo and they are doing a good job in the wet, dry, sand & anything thrown at it. So no plans of changing her shoes until 30-35k kms when they start wearing out.
The controls though reversed are chunky and of good quality. You will get used to the center console and the reversed light and wiper controls very soon. The only downside with the center console is the rear pax can see the speeds you are doing and if it’s the uncles/aunties then they start losing it even before the needle is touching the tip of the 100 kmph mark.
High speed stability is very good. The highest done on NICE road before the mods was 130 kmph after which I ran out of road and also had a guilt to revv her all the more. After the mods, well no guilt at all as she begs to be revved and yes she gets it. The top speed was 145kmph in the same NICE road.
The car has completed 11200 trouble free kms in the last 14 months. The mileage figures before mods was around 13 kmpl in the city with AC and 16-17 kmpl on the highway with AC. After mods, it was initially lower by 0.5 kms but after 500kms of driving with mods, the mileage has settled at 13.5 kmpl with AC in the city and 18 kmpl on the highway with AC.

The GROUSE:
Now with everything so perfect, I should have been over the moon right? WRONG. I was not. Agreed it was a great city car with amazing low and mid end. But the top end was totally disappointing. Take it to 3000 RPM and you feel the engine is being choked by the intake/exhaust. And again the engine is not happy to be revved in any gear. She is most relaxed with 2000-2200 RPM shifts be it city or highway. This was a dampener for me and I started looking for options. Enter ENGINE CAL.

I took my car to check if there was space for any mods. They examined the engine bay and confirmed that there was good potential for mods in the car. We sat and had a round table about my requirements. I told them that I want the car to be a bit freer revving than it currently is and I was not looking at major BHP gains or anything.
They heard me out patiently and recommended that I go in for 4X2X1 header set up along with a resonator and muffler tip for the growl and go for a conical performance air filter for starters. I agreed on the spot as the knowledge they displayed during our chat was immense and I could believe them that no harm would come to my car in their capable hands.

They were accommodating enough to come home to pick up my car and take it for the headers work. The headers were designed at Raj Hingorani's place but the specs were provided by Engine Cal. The fabrication of the headers was supervised by them and they selected a very sweet exhaust note to go with the headers. They managed to get the fabricator to design the headers in such a way that my stock engine heat shield would fit on it. Kudos!! They also chose a BMC conical air filter for my car based on the engine capacity. The combo was very good and the moment I heard the car I fell in love with the exhaust note. They were also very thorough in the fact that all the stock parts including the stock exhaust were arranged neatly and brought back in the car without as much as staining the beige seat covers. Goes to show the extent of care these guys take when they are handling the vehicle.

I am revving the car in each gear starting from the 2nd till the 5th and loving every bit of it. The car has become lot more free revving and it can revv upto 3000 RPM without breaking a sweat in each gear. It has got a lot of juice left to take it further as well.

Major changes i observed were as below:
1. Free revving in all gears
2. Load with AC is not noticeable. In stock condition i was forced to be in 2nd gear in a particular speed with AC, the same can now be done in 3rd and the engine does not feel strained with AC
3. Acceleration feels lot better though i am not interested in timing it.
4. The sweet sweet sound of the exhaust. Top marks for the Engine Cal guys for helping me with a very subtle sounding but sweet sounding exhaust note

Change in mileage was noticed initially as it dropped by 0.5-1km. I was not too bothered but the guys assured me that there will be a slight bump a little later on. True to their words, after i got used to the way the car drives with the mods, it increased by 0.5km in the city and 1 km in the highway runs both with AC.
